Output 7121cb71dbb51d577953e254b8c7660b38f253695c8a78f3ee3b12b27c17a46a:0

value
120132286
script pubkey
OP_0 OP_PUSHBYTES_20 ddc1582178ba517d73fea1a23873285d29bca5e2
address
bc1qmhq4sgtchfgh6ul75x3rsuegt55mef0zx3ehm2
transaction
7121cb71dbb51d577953e254b8c7660b38f253695c8a78f3ee3b12b27c17a46a
confirmations
76290
spent
true